Verse 1

8:1 Gittith. (l-7) * See also Psalms 81:0 and 84. A musical instrument. The word is feminine. set (m-26) Possibly imperative, it would then read, '... earth! because of which set thou,' &c.

Verse 2

8:2 praise (n-12) Or 'founded strength;' same word as in Psalms 68:34 ; Psalms 96:6 ,Psalms 96:7 ; Psalms 132:8 . adversaries, (o-16) Tzar , the 'adversary' of Christ, or 'oppressor' of the remnant, from within, as Psalms 3:1 ; Psalms 27:2 ,Psalms 27:12 . enemy (p-20) Oyeb , external 'enemy,' as Exodus 15:9 ; Exodus 23:22 ; Numbers 10:35 .

Verse 4

8:4 man, (q-3) Enosh , 'feeble,' 'mortal man,' man looked at as a race, in contrast with distinguished individuals. see Genesis 4:26 ; Psalms 144:3 . man, (r-14) Adam . visitest (s-17) Or 'regardest.'

Verse 5

8:5 little (t-6) Or 'some little.' angels, (u-10) Elohim . see Psalms 97:7 .
